PURPOSE: A method for detecting a parking space using a mesh type spatial analysis and a system thereof are provided to virtually divide a target space into areas forming a mesh at certain distances, and then sequentially exclude the areas in which obstacles are not detected based on a detecting signal from an ultrasonic sensor in case of detecting the parking space using the ultrasonic sensor, thereby removing information distortion in detecting the space.;CONSTITUTION: A system for detecting a parking space using a mesh type spatial analysis includes a transmitting part(10), a receiving part(20), a mesh type spatial setting part(31), a non-obstacle area determining part(32), and a controller(33). The transmitting part transmits an ultrasonic signal according to a predetermined control signal, and the receiving part receives an echo signal which is the returning ultrasonic signal from an object. The mesh type spatial setting part sets a virtual area on a target parking space to which an ultrasonic wave is radiated from the transmitting part, and then stores the data of a mesh type spatial image in which the area is divided into cells at certain distances. The non-obstacle area determining part analyzes the echo signal, and then determines a non-obstacle area against the mesh type divided area set by the mesh type spatial setting part.
